Is Bill O’Reilly — the scandal-plagued Fox News commentator who, along with Fox News, reportedly paid out $13 million in settlements to multiple women who’ve accused him of sexual harassment or inappropriate behavior — being targeted because of his deep pockets?

That’s the question that actor and comedian D.L. Hughley put to the listeners of his radio show on Tuesday, after multiple sponsors cut ties with O’Reilly’s show.

“We asked this about Bill Cosby, now we’ll ask about O’Reilly. Do you think he’s guilty or a rich man who’s become an easy target?” “The D.L. Hughley Show” tweeted Tuesday.

“I think that sometimes people have been targeted because of their wealth and fame,” Hughley offered during the show, though he likened O’Reilly’s situation to that of the AMC period drama “Mad Men,” where men had their run of things.

While a number of listeners were happy to render a guilty verdict against the “The O’Reilly Factor” host, Hughley suggested that O’Reilly might have few options beyond luring women into sexual situations with his wealth.

“When you look like Bill O’Reilly that’s why God invented three things: Midnight, alcohol and money,” Hughley joked.

Comparing O’Reilly to Cosby — who has also been targeted by multiple allegations sexual assault — Hughley offered a simple solution to the situation.

“I think we should just pass a law: Stay away from cats named Bill,” Hughley offered.
